Imagine yourself a resident at The Citrus Club in La Quinta, California, enjoying the sweet fragrance of citrus groves from your patio while you look out over verdant fairways framed by expansive skies and the rugged Santa Rosa Mountains. With executive homes expressing various architectural styles available both on and off the fairways of Citrus Gold Club, you may be surprised at the level of amenities to be found far away from the frenetic pace of the city. The Citrus Golf Club, is the unique vision of Pete Dye who located it within vast citrus groves a mere seven years after the incorporation of La Quinta in 1982.

Enjoy the advantage of membership discounts in any of the club’s three restaurants, or entertain visiting friends or family in the View Par’s relaxing setting. When you want to pick up the pace, visit downtown La Quinta. With so many art festivals and concerts in addition to the shopping and dining opportunities in “Old Town,” (www.oldtownlaquinta.com) you’ll never run out of new and interesting places to visit or things to do.

Continue driving east, and you’ll find the 750-acre Lake Cahuilla Recreation Area (www.Rivcoparks.org) where camping, boating and fishing opportunities abound in and around the 135-acre lake. Beyond, the Santa Rosa and San Jacinto National Monument lands boast more than 200,000 acres of remote wilderness, including peaks rising over 10,000 feet adding to the lure of the Coachella Valley as a backcountry destination.

Home ownership in this unique development brings with it the privilege of membership in an elite golf club which has hosted numerous PGA and nationally televised events. In addition to golf, the amenities open to you include the new fitness facility, lap pools and tennis courts. With so much to offer, including an average temp of 75 degrees and an annual rainfall less than five inches, there is something to do or see virtually every month of the year in La Quinta. Topping the long list of exciting cultural events are the annual Bob Hope Classic golf tournament, the Jacqueline Cochran Air Show, the Riverside County Fair & National Date Festival, and the Desert Classic Concours d’Elegance, a world class exhibition of more than 200 classic cars. Don’t forget the Coachella Music Festival (www.Coachella.com), an event annually attended by more than 225,000 people!

When you call the Coachella Valley you home, take comfort in the assurance that everything you need is close at hand. In addition to its lively commerce, La Quinta’s municipal government has libraries, senior services, museums and its own state of the art emergency preparedness plan. The area’s three hospitals, Desert Regional Medical Center, Eisenhower Medical Center, and JFK Memorial Hospital, are each easily accessible to residents of Citrus. All three of these facilities have received recognition for the quality of their care, with Eisenhower Medical Center (www.emc.org) having earned special national distinction for pioneering innovative cardiac care in addition to its role as a teaching hospital. These La Quinta resources only add value to the home waiting for you at The Citrus Club.
